Carcosa, Seri Negara not for sale, says govt

The tourism ministry says they are being being conserved as national heritage sites.

The tourism ministry has been given the green light to redevelop Carcosa and Seri Negara as tourist attractions.
KUALA LUMPUR:
The Carcosa and Seri Negara are not for sale as they are protected heritage buildings, tourism, arts and culture ministry secretary-general Isham Ishak said today.

He said the buildings are being preserved and conserved as national heritage sites under the National Heritage Act 2005.

The land and buildings cannot be sold but the government is open to providing concessions for the operation of the buildings, he told reporters on the sidelines of the World Tourism Conference 2019 here.

The ministry had announced previously that it has been given the green light to redevelop Carcosa and Seri Negara as tourist attractions.

Isham said an evaluation is being carried on the mansions, including a forensic study on their structural safety.
